Studying Online at East Georgia State College
Distance learning is available at East Georgia State College. Among 1,820 students, 535 (29%) studied exclusively online and 618 (34%) took at least some classes online.
Student Demographics & Diversity
The following sections describe the student demographics for Educational Administration graduates at East Georgia State College, by degree type.
Across all degree levels, Educational Administration graduates at East Georgia State College are 78% women (21) and 22% men (6).
Educational Administration Associate’s Program at East Georgia State College
Of the 27 associate’s educational administration graduates at East Georgia State College, 78% were women (21) and 22% were men (6).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Educational Administration associate’s degree recipients at East Georgia State College.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 19 |
| Black / African American | 7 |
| Two or More Races | 1 |
Minority students account for 30% of Educational Administration associate’s degree recipients at East Georgia State College, below the national average of 32%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
